Location and Accessibility

The Royal Oak is situated in Biddulph, Staffordshire, providing convenient access to nearby attractions such as Biddulph Grange Garden and the Peak District National Park. Just 15 miles from Stoke-on-Trent, it offers picturesque surroundings and a welcoming environment. The hotel is easily reachable via major road networks, ensuring straightforward travel plans.

Accommodations

The Royal Oak offers 10 well-appointed guest rooms, featuring ensuite bathrooms equipped with modern amenities. Each room provides a comfortable retreat, designed for a pleasant stay. Guests can choose from various room types to suit their individual needs.

Dining Options

The on-site restaurant at The Royal Oak serves a selection of traditional British dishes, prepared with locally sourced ingredients. Visitors can enjoy a diverse menu complemented by a carefully curated drinks list. Daily specials and seasonal offerings provide variety during dining experiences.

Outdoor Spaces

The hotel features an inviting outdoor terrace where guests can unwind and indulge in refreshing drinks. This space presents an excellent option for al fresco dining during warmer months. The surrounding garden area enhances the countryside feel, providing a charming backdrop.

excellent stay!

friendly stafffresh milklocal diningcozy room
i found the staff friendly i felt very welcome from the start. i really liked the fresh milk provided upon my arrival it was a great touch. i got useful information about local dining options which was helpful. the room felt so cozy.
the car park felt a bit small i had to move some outdoor seating tables to fit my car this was slightly inconvenient but manageable
Service
9/10
the host greeted me with such warmth i felt very welcome. they also gave me great recommendations for places where i could eat which i found very useful and considerate.
Dining
8/10
the pub downstairs provided a lively atmosphere i really loved that. i also appreciated the convenience of having drinks readily available right within the premises. i enjoyed the live music played downstairs.
Rooms
10/10
my room was large and it had a contemporary feel this. i found the bed very comfy i slept soundly throughout my stay. the fresh water available in the mini bar was excellent
Location
9/10
the location was perfect i could easily cycle on the nearby disused railway. i had a great time exploring the biddulph valley way i really enjoyed the convenience of the location. it suited both my work and leisure needs very well
Facilities
10/10
my beautiful king room included superb shower facilities i loved it. i also enjoyed the tv available in the room it offered great entertainment options. overall the facilities exceeded my expectations

Acceptable but Problematic Stay

on-site parkingbad sound insulationunconcerned staff
The on-site parking suited my visit.
The room was above a busy bar. Bad sound insulation meant I could hear everything happening downstairs. A fire alarm even went off while I was asleep. Staff seemed less than concerned..
